Robert moses: ny state and city official whose public works for the 30s, 40s, and. 50s transformed ny city: master builder of the mi-20th century ny city. 1000s of people, uprooted people by building expressways through them. After he began to redesign highways, made sure bridges giving access to beaches and parks that trucks could not go through. Not only trucks that couldn"t go through, buses as well. Taking busses in 50s and 60s was only option to those not rich enough to own a car. (many were black)
